The Macao Institute for Tourism Studies (IFTM) has signed an Articulation Agreement with leading Swiss institutions Les Roches Global Hospitality Education (Les Roches) and Glion Institute of Higher Education (GIHE) to provide a “top-up” study plan to IFTM’s Bachelor of Science in Hotel Management students following a “3+1” learning model.

The agreement enables IFTM and the two institutions to collaborate and “enrich” students’ academic journey. Students completing the first three years at IFTM and the stipulated requirements of the two institutions in any of their campuses (Switzerland, Spain or the UK) can get a bachelor’s degree awarded by IFTM and Les Roches or GIHE.

Four IFTM students are currently undertaking the dual programme in Les Roches’ campus in Spain in the Academic Year 2022/2023.

IFTM recently invited Hospitality Consultant and Alumni Ambassador Kavi Khemlani and Regional Admissions Manager Veronica Yin to brief students about the dual programme, drawing an enthusiastic response. 

GIHE and Les Roches come under the Sommet Education group and are ranked in the top five of the QS World University Rankings by Subjects 2022 for Hospitality and Leisure Management, The Macau Post Daily reported.
